What is a motel?
Motel properties often include free parking, and many have outdoor pools. Often one or two stories tall, motels usually have exterior corridors overlooking the parking lot or an outdoor pool. In the U.S., motels became more commonplace after World War II with the popularity of car travel and road trips, peaking in the mid-1960s with more than 60,000 properties.
What can I do in Stanley?
Visitors to Stanley like its mountain landscape and restaurants. As you’re sightseeing around the area, be sure to enjoy all there is to see and do. These are some of the parks and outdoorsy places: Stanley Lake, Redfish Outlet Lake, and Sawtooth National Recreation Area. To learn more about local history, take some time at Yankee Fork Gold Dredge and Custer Ghost Town. During your trip, here are some other places to visit: Boise National Forest, Salmon River, and Salmon-Challis National Forest.
What's the seasonal weather like in Stanley?
Weather can make or break a roadtrip, so we’ve gathered some data about year-round temperatures in Stanley to help you plan yours. The hottest months are usually July and August with an average temp of 57°F, while the coldest months are December and January with an average of 19°F. The snowiest months in Stanley are February, March, January, and December, with each month seeing an average of 13 inches of snowfall.
